Enhancement request (I think): I am using the "Tools / Text Importer" tool to load data from .csv files. The data given to me in a file from an analyst is imperfect. Tonight I had 19 out of 579 records that were rejected due to errors. What I would like is a "Rejected record" file or window. If I had that, I would choose "Continue" after each error, and then I would send the "Rejected record" records back to the person who created the data file to let the analyst know that all but the bad records were imported successfully. Then presumably, the analyst would fix the bad records and send back a file with corrected records.

To give some more context to this request, I am using Text Importer instead of using SQL*Loader, and remember that SQL*Loader creates a .bad file of rejected records. I just want the same end result--a set of rejected records. (Does this feature already exist? I looked but could not find it.)
